Sydney’s dining scene no longer relies on the Opera House silhouette to do the heavy lifting. Finding a view isn't the challenge. It’s securing a table before the 6:00 PM rush claims every seat from Surry Hills to Bondi. Locals treat reservations like currency. You plan your weekend around a booking, not the other way around. The city has traded white-tablecloth stuffiness for a high-octane blend of coastal energy and sharp, global technique.

The current momentum favors intimacy over scale. At Restaurant Ka, the focus narrows to just ten seats, turning dinner into a choreographed performance of Cantonese-inflected precision. Compare that to the salt-licked energy of Topikós. Here, the Greek-inspired menu mirrors the breezy confidence of Bondi Beach just outside the door. Even newcomers like Allta and ORIBU prove that Sydney’s obsession with craft remains its most reliable heartbeat.

You won’t find these places by accident. You find them by knowing where the city is heading next. These are the tables worth the hunt.

02.Topikós

What is it? Topikós brings a sharp, modern energy to the Sydney dining scene. The space functions as both a dedicated dining room and a high-energy bar. White-washed walls and a clean coastal aesthetic signal a contemporary take on Greek traditions.

Why we love it: The kitchen delivers Greek flavors with precision. Locals lean against the bar with glasses of chilled wine before moving into the dining room for a full meal. It captures the rhythm of a modern taverna designed for a polished city crowd.

Good to Know: The charred grilled octopus at Topikós pairs best with a crisp glass of Assyrtiko.

07.Shaffa

What is it? Shaffa is a Sydney restaurant that prioritizes social energy and movement. The space feels tucked away from the main drag, offering a mix of bar seating and outdoor seating. It is a spot where the energy peaks during the dinner rush.

Why we love it: The open kitchen transforms the dining room into a live show. Chefs work the line with precision, making this a great choice for groups who enjoy a fast-paced environment. The menu is vegetarian friendly and encourages a shared dining experience where plates crowd the table.

Good to Know: Order the wood-fired cauliflower at Shaffa; the deep caramelization pairs perfectly with the creamy tahini.
